.cw-visually-hidden{position:absolute!important;height:1px;width:1px;overflow:hidden;clip:rect(1px,1px,1px,1px);white-space:nowrap}.cw-footer{background:var(--cw-footer-bg, #0A0A0A);color:var(--cw-footer-text, #FFFFFF)}.cw-footer__inner{max-width:1800px;margin:0 auto;padding:50px 58px}.cw-footer__top{display:grid;grid-template-columns:minmax(260px,317px) 1fr minmax(260px,360px);gap:50px;align-items:start}.cw-footer__left{display:flex;flex-direction:column;align-items:flex-start}.cw-footer__brand{display:inline-flex;align-items:center;text-decoration:none;color:inherit}.cw-footer__logo{width:80px;height:auto}.cw-footer__logo-text{font-family:IBM Plex Mono,monospace;font-size:22px;letter-spacing:.02em}.cw-footer__newsletter{width:100%;margin-top:16px}.cw-footer__newsletter-form{width:100%;margin:0}.cw-footer__newsletter-form *{box-sizing:border-box}.cw-footer__newsletter-row{display:flex;align-items:stretch;width:100%}.cw-footer__input{flex:1;height:46px;padding:12px 16px;border:1px solid rgba(255,255,255,.35);background:#fff;color:#0a0a0a;font-family:IBM Plex Mono,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;font-size:14px;line-height:1;outline:none}.cw-footer__input::placeholder{color:#0a0a0a8c}.cw-footer__button{height:46px;padding:16px;border:1px solid rgba(255,255,255,.35);border-left:0;background:var(--cw-footer-btn, #333333);color:#fff;font-family:IBM Plex Mono,monospace;font-size:14px;font-weight:500;line-height:1;cursor:pointer;white-space:nowrap}.cw-footer__button:hover{filter:brightness(1.05)}.cw-footer__form-msg{margin:10px 0 0;font-family:IBM Plex Mono,ui-monospace,monospace;font-size:12px;opacity:.9}.cw-footer__join{margin-top:16px;display:flex;flex-direction:column;gap:8px}.cw-footer__join-title{font-family:IBM Plex Mono,monospace;font-size:14px;opacity:.95}.cw-footer__social{margin:0;padding:0;list-style:none}.cw-footer__social-link{display:inline-flex;align-items:center;gap:8px;text-decoration:none;color:#fff;font-family:IBM Plex Mono,monospace;font-size:14px}.cw-footer__social-link:hover{color:var(--cw-footer-muted, rgba(255,255,255,.7));text-decoration:underline;text-underline-offset:2px}.cw-footer__social-link svg{width:24px;height:24px;display:block}.cw-footer__center{display:flex;width:100%;min-width:500px;height:196px;flex-direction:column;justify-content:center;align-items:center;gap:16px}.cw-footer__statement{color:#fff;text-align:center;font-family:Playfair Display;font-size:40px;font-style:normal;font-weight:400;line-height:100%;text-transform:uppercase}.cw-footer__right{display:flex;justify-content:flex-end}.cw-footer__menus{display:grid;grid-template-columns:1fr 1fr;gap:50px;align-items:start}.cw-footer__menu-title,.cw-footer__location-title{font-family:IBM Plex Mono;font-size:16px;font-style:normal;font-weight:600;line-height:normal;text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:auto;text-decoration-thickness:auto;text-underline-offset:auto;text-underline-position:from-font;text-transform:uppercase;padding-bottom:20px}.cw-footer__location-title:hover{color:var(--cw-footer-muted, rgba(255, 255, 255, .7))}.cw-footer__menu-title{color:var(--cw-footer-muted, rgba(255,255,255,.7))}.cw-footer__location-title{color:#fff}.cw-footer__menu-list{margin:0;padding:0;list-style:none;display:grid;gap:10px}.cw-footer__menu-link{color:#fff;opacity:1;font-family:IBM Plex Mono;font-size:16px;font-style:normal;font-weight:400;line-height:24px;text-decoration:none}.cw-footer__menu-link:hover{color:var(--cw-footer-muted, rgba(255,255,255,.7));text-decoration:underline;text-underline-offset:2px}.cw-footer__menu-link--caps{text-transform:uppercase;font-weight:600;color:#fff}.cw-footer__divider{border:0;border-top:1px solid var(--cw-footer-line, rgba(255,255,255,.1));margin:50px 0}.cw-footer__locations-grid{display:grid;grid-template-columns:repeat(5,minmax(0,1fr));gap:50px}.cw-footer__location-line{color:#fff;opacity:.7;font-family:IBM Plex Mono;font-size:14px;font-style:normal;font-weight:400;line-height:normal;gap:10px;padding-bottom:10px}.cw-footer__location-link{color:inherit;text-decoration:none}.cw-footer__location-link:hover{color:var(--cw-footer-muted, rgba(255,255,255,.7))}.cw-footer__bottom{display:flex;justify-content:center}.cw-footer__bottom-links{margin:0;padding:0;list-style:none;display:flex;gap:28px;flex-wrap:wrap;justify-content:center}.cw-footer__bottom-link{text-decoration:none;color:#fff;font-family:IBM Plex Mono;font-size:16px;font-style:normal;font-weight:400;line-height:20px}.cw-footer__bottom-link:hover{color:var(--cw-footer-muted, rgba(255,255,255,.7));text-decoration:underline;text-underline-offset:2px}@media(max-width:1023px){.cw-footer__inner{padding:40px 24px}.cw-footer__top{grid-template-columns:1fr;gap:28px}.cw-footer__right{justify-content:flex-start}.cw-footer__menus{gap:28px}.cw-footer__locations-grid{grid-template-columns:repeat(2,minmax(0,1fr));gap:28px}.cw-footer__center{display:none}}@media(max-width:767px){.cw-footer__inner{padding:32px 18px}.cw-footer__menus{grid-template-columns:1fr;gap:18px}.cw-footer__locations-grid{grid-template-columns:1fr;gap:22px}.cw-footer__bottom-links{gap:14px}}.cw-footer__location-title-link{display:inline-block;color:#fff;text-decoration-line:underline;text-decoration-style:solid;text-decoration-skip-ink:auto;text-decoration-thickness:auto;text-underline-offset:auto;text-underline-position:from-font;text-transform:uppercase;padding-bottom:20px}.cw-footer__location-title-link:hover{color:var(--cw-footer-muted, rgba(255, 255, 255, .7))}
/*# sourceMappingURL=/cdn/shop/t/22/assets/footer-commonwealth.css.map */
